C & C Group Public Net Profit Margin Growth & History (CCR)
C & C Group Public's net profit margin was 0.22% for fiscal 2026.
View full C & C Group Public company overviewC & C Group Public annual net profit margin history
| Fiscal year | Period ended | Net profit margin | Change (percentage points)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| 2026-02-28 | 0.22% | −0.59 pp |
| 2025 | 2025-02-28 | 0.82% | +7.68 pp |
| 2024 | 2024-02-29 | −6.87% | −9.26 pp |
| 2023 | 2023-02-28 | 2.39% | −0.19 pp |
| 2022 | 2022-02-28 | 2.58% | +16.76 pp |
| 2021 | 2021-02-28 | −14.18% | — |
C & C Group Public net profit margin trends
Over the last five fiscal years, C & C Group Public's net profit margin increased from −14.18% to 0.22%, a change of +14.40 percentage points.
What net profit margin means
Net profit margin measures the percentage of revenue remaining as net income after operating costs, interest, taxes, and other expenses. It shows how much bottom-line profit or loss a company generates from each dollar of revenue.
How net profit margin is calculated
TickerStat calculates net profit margin as reported net income divided by reported revenue for the same fiscal period. Changes are shown in percentage points.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
